Breastfeeding 101 is a prenatal breastfeeding education class. It is facilitated by an IBCLC (International Board Certified Lactation Consultant) and is held the second Thursday of each month at 10:00 AM at Full Circle Medical Center for Women in Athens, TN.

Breastfeeding Circle is an awesome resource for all things breastfeeding. It is completely mother-led which means you can get all of your questions answered. From help with teething and introducing solids all the way to weaning, we've got you covered!
Breastfeeding Circle Support Group is held the fourth Thursday of each month at Full Circle Medical Center for Women in Athens, TN.
